WHAT ARE THE MAIN DIFFERENCES BETWEEN THE PRIVATE THE PUBLIC AND VOLUNTARY SECTOR?

The private sector is composed of businesses and organizations that operate for profit and are owned by individuals or shareholders. The public sector includes government entities and organizations that provide public services funded by taxpayer money, focusing on the welfare of citizens. The voluntary sector, often referred to as the nonprofit sector, consists of organizations that operate independently of government and profit motives, relying on donations and volunteers to address social issues and community needs. Each sector has distinct goals, funding mechanisms, and operational frameworks, influencing their roles in society.

What are the roles and responsibilities of public relation department?

The public relations (PR) department is responsible for managing an organization's image and communication with the public, media, and stakeholders. Its key roles include crafting press releases, managing media relations, and developing strategic communication plans. Additionally, the PR team handles crisis communication, monitors public perception, and engages with the community to build and maintain positive relationships. Overall, their goal is to enhance the organization's reputation and effectively convey its messages.

Why has the public sector grown so rapidly in recent years?

The rapid growth of the public sector in recent years can be attributed to several factors, including increased demand for public services due to population growth and aging demographics. Economic challenges, such as those posed by the COVID-19 pandemic, have also led governments to expand their roles in healthcare, social services, and economic support. Additionally, rising concerns about inequality and social welfare have prompted governments to implement more robust programs, further expanding the public sector's reach and responsibilities.
